Weather radar, also known as weather surveillance radar, is an important technology used in meteorology to locate precipitation, calculate its motion, and estimate its type. It is mounted on fixed stations or mobile platforms, such as ships, aircraft and satellites, to observe atmospheric conditions from a distance. Weather radars send out pulses of microwave energy which illuminate atmospheric water and dust particles. The reflection of these pulses is detected, measured and used to infer the distance and size of particles, showing the location and movement of precipitation, along with other important meteorological data. Over the past few decades, weather radars have evolved significantly with technological innovations, enabling better spatial resolution and accuracy as well as additional modes like dual polarization. They are now playing a critical role in weather forecasting and severe storm tracking to issue timely warnings.

Segment Analysis

The weather radar market is segmented into dual polarization, single polarization and Doppler. The dual polarization segment dominates the market and accounts for over 60% share. Dual polarization radars provide higher resolution images with distinction between rain, snow, hail and other particles. They have become a standard now for weather monitoring agencies owing to enhanced detection capabilities.
